Ireland may need local lockdowns if Covid cases continue to increase rapidly, according to the World Health Organisation.
The country's seven-day moving average is over 2,000 cases, compared to just over 1,100 three weeks ago.
And 470 Covid patients were in public hospitals last night, up from 291 a month ago.
